A post mortem examination will be carried out later on the body of David Byrne, who was stabbed to death in Dublin on Saturday night.

The 19-year-old was chased by a gang of four youths into the car park of an apartment block in Inchicore where he was attacked.

He was pronounced dead in hospital a short time later.

Superintendent John Gilligan has said they are following a number of lines of enquiry.
